Instagram API - 如何处理数据中的表情符号?

时间:2016-07-29 23:51:31

标签: python json api instagram

所以我一直在搞乱Instagram API(客户端),每次表情符号都涉及到数据时我都会遇到问题。

我的代码:

import requests
import json

response = requests.get("https://api.instagram.com/v1/users/self/?access_token=ACCESS_TOKEN")
status_code = response.status_code

if(status_code == 200):
    data = response.json()

错误抛出:

  

UnicodeEncodeError:'UCS-2'编解码器无法对字符进行编码   135-135:Tk

中不支持非BMP字符

在我的Instagram帐号简历中,我有一个表情符号(熊表情符号)。任何时候看到表情符号时都会抛出此错误。如果我删除表情符号并重新运行则没有错误。

Bio数据如下所示:

  

“bio”:“\ ud83d \ udc3b”

问题:我该怎么做才能让代码接受表情符号,或者我该如何从数据中完全删除表情符号?

0 个答案:

没有答案